Durban – As matric learners across the country await their final examinations, IOL has decided to publish the 2021 final NSC maths literacy question paper, addendum and memo (for Paper 1 and Paper 2) in the first edition of its Final Matric Revision Digimag.
Statistics show that in 2021, a little over 50% of learners passed the maths literacy exam: 259 143 learners wrote and 149 177 passed.
In pure maths, 196 968 learners sat down to write the exam and 135 915 passed.
The overall 2021 matric pass rate was 76.4%, a 0.2% improvement from the previous year.
